DJI Avata: DJI’s Cheapest FPV Drone with 4K Video Capability

Rumors of a second FPV drone from DJI have proven true. Named Avata , the presence of this drone is also accompanied by two new accessories, namely DJI Googles 2 and DJI Motion Controller.

Features of DJI Avata

Prioritizing agility and speed Avata is designed with a very compact and light weight. More compact than the previous DJI FPV . To fly this drone relies on a four-propeller system. Each propeller has added aerodynamic guards for additional safety.

Avata is also equipped with a capable camera system. The camera relies on a 1/1.7-inch CMOS sensor with a resolution of 48 megapixels. The video recording capability can be up to 4K/60fps and 120fps at 2.7K resolution. Right in front of the sensor can be found a wide-angle lens. The lens can capture images up to an angle of 155 degrees with an aperture of F2.8.

The video mode is also supported by the D-Cinelike mode. The DJI RockSteady and DJI HorizonSteady stabilizer features are also available to stabilize the shot. The photos and videos can then be saved to the internal memory which has a capacity of 20GB. If it’s not enough, it can still be added through the help of a microSD memory card.

Avata can fly for 18 minutes. This drone also brings one new feature, namely Turtle Mode. As the name implies, this mode will automatically flip the drone up if it lands on its back. Then, the drone will be ready to be flown again.

Another new feature Avata is equipped with an emergency brake. When pressed the drone will automatically stop and hover in place. In addition, there is also a Failsafe Return Home feature that will allow the drone to fly to the starting point of an automatic flight or when the battery is running low.

Other features Avata is equipped with a GEO 2.0 geofencing system, AirSense ADS-B and AeroScope technology. So, it can be flown safely and avoid obstacles that are around it. Flight modes such as Normal, Manual, and Sport are also available and can be selected according to user needs.

DJI Googles 2 and DJI Motion Controller

The DJI Googles 2 is DJI’s most compact and lightweight video headset. To display the image, this video headset brings a Micro OLED screen with diopter settings and a touch panel. Googles 2 can connect to Avata via DJI O3+ transmission. Users can stream from Avata cameras at 1080p resolutions up to 100fps from a distance of up to 10 Km.

Meanwhile, the DJI Motion Controller is a control stick that will offer easier and more flexible control. Through the Motion Controller, users can control the Avata with more precision only through hand movements. Similar to using the Oculus Rift VR headset or HTC Vive Pro 2. It can be an alternative for users who are not used to flying drones with a remote control.

DJI Avata price

This drone has been sold with prices starting from US $ 629 or around 9 million Rupiah. This price is for the DJI Avata drone unit only. Pro-View Combo Package with DJI Googles 2 and DJI Motion Controller US$1,388. The Fly Smart Combo package which includes the DJI FPV Goggles V2 and DJI Motion Controller costs US$1168.
